How to Know When It’s Time to Call

Not every leaning tree is a disaster in the making—but it’s always safer to get a second opinion. Key warning signs include:

  • Cracks in the trunk or major limbs
  • Sudden leaning or shifting
  • Exposed roots or soil movement around the base
  • Branches breaking off in calm weather
  • Bark falling away or visible rot
